The Tuesday Morning Bird Walk with Clay Christensen and the St. Paul Audubon 
group birded at Reservoir Woods in Roseville this morning.  The highlight of 
our morning was a Yellow-billed Cuckoo.  Park at the entrance on the north side 
of Larpenteur Ave., between Dale and Rice Streets (across the street from 
Elmhurst Cemetery).  Follow the paved path into the ravine, past the dog park, 
up through the pine trees, and downhill again.  Watch for an unpaved path to 
the right.  Follow that.  We had heard the Cuckoo calling when we were by the 
pine trees.  We saw Indigo Buntings in the shrubby, open area on our left, then 
spotted this YBC further along the path - in the trees on the left just before 
the pond comes into view.  The Cuckoo was secretive at first, then came out on 
a bare tree branch to pose for us at length -about 7 feet off the ground and 
quite close to the path.  The day was cool, windy, and cloudy.  The time was 
about 9 am.
